GoRogue
GoRogue copied to clipboard
Modify SenseMap code to allow for custom-spreading algorithms
While ripple and shadowcasting cover a great many cases, it may not be difficult to allow for the support of customized algorithms for sources. If SenseSource could be subclassed in a way that allows this, this would allow the SenseMap (aggregation/auto calculation) functionality to still apply to a user that needs a custom algorithm.
Pushing to 3.0 as this may produce being changes to the way Sense map currently operates